Council Election: South Hampstead - 7 May 2026

There was a council election in South Hampstead (Camden) on 7 May 2026.

3 candidates were elected.

The outcome was as follows:

Candidate Party Votes Elected?
Izzy Lenga Labour Party 1,006 Elected
Francesca Marie Reynolds Labour Party 930 Elected
Arun Kumar Labour Party 925 Elected
Susan Aykroyd Conservative and Unionist Party 816 No
Tara Michelle-Louise Copeland Liberal Democrats 795 No
Andrea Cornwall Green Party 758 No
CJ Jessup Green Party 711 No
Pranay Hariharan Liberal Democrats 706 No
Laurence Edward Dimitri Lodge Liberal Democrats 693 No
Andy Marsh Conservative and Unionist Party 679 No
Wakjira Feyesa Conservative and Unionist Party 637 No
John Payne Green Party 618 No
Douglas de Morais Reform UK 261 No
Valerie Moss Reform UK 247 No

What Happened Last Time in South Hampstead?

The previous council election in South Hampstead was held on 5 May 2022.

3 candidates were elected.

The outcome was as follows:

Candidate Party Votes Elected?
Nina de Ayala Parker Labour Party 1,692 Elected
Izzy Lenga Labour Party 1,655 Elected
Will Prince Labour Party 1,564 Elected
Don Williams Conservative and Unionist Party 976 No
Calvin Po Conservative and Unionist Party 947 No
Marx de Morais Conservative and Unionist Party 931 No
James Philip Baker Liberal Democrats 436 No
Aimery de Malet Roquefort Liberal Democrats 424 No
Pranay Hariharan Liberal Democrats 376 No
